German Constitutional Court at the Commission

Maroš Šefčovič welcomed the President of the German Constitutional Court, Andreas Voßkuhle.

Vice-President Maroš Šefčovič welcomed on Monday 22 April the President of the German Constitutional Court, Andreas Voßkuhle, as well as its Vice-President Kirchhoff, and judges Eichberger and Huber.

They held an exchange of views on the decision-making procedures in the EU, and V-P Šefčovič provided an insight into his day-to-day work with the European Parliament and the Council. He also shared his first experiences with the European Citizens' Initiative.

The delegation afterwards met the President of the Commission, José Manuel Barroso, and held a conference at the Commission's Legal Service and members of the Legal Services of the Council and the EP.

V-P Šefčovič stressed once again the importance of personal contacts between the various actors on EU and national stages.

The visit of the German Court officials to Brussels reciprocated an earlier visit to the Constitutional Court by V-P Šefčovič  in September 2011 following a meeting with Commission staff in Karlsruhe at the Institute for Transuranium Elements.
